Transaction 3101e0309c2285739a2175112b3415ba65fdef8712ac696a61e7b6e2de0f9945

2 Input
2 Outputs
  • 3101e0309c2285739a2175112b3415ba65fdef8712ac696a61e7b6e2de0f9945:0
  • value  756741
    address  14ekbWqCnuF1RgG21cP3nctZZeYMXrUvGR
  • 3101e0309c2285739a2175112b3415ba65fdef8712ac696a61e7b6e2de0f9945:1
  • value  9968000
    address  35b6SCukBWvHL3EuL4E9aNdx3CBGp2JCHz